Imaging Technology Update

Medtech recently partnered with the Radiological Society of Mauritius to host an influential medical conference featuring Prof. Musturay Karcaaltincaba, a renowned radiology expert from Turkey. Supported by an unrestricted grant from Medtech, this event represented a significant advancement in continuing medical education within Mauritius, particularly in MRI technology.

Innovations in Body MRI Techniques

The conference began with Prof. Karcaaltincaba presenting on the latest advancements in Body MRI, detailing novel diagnostic methods that enhance the accuracy of assessing conditions related to the liver, pancreas, spleen, and kidneys. He focused on the importance of the Liver Imaging Reporting and Data System (LIRADS), which plays a pivotal role in refining the assessment of liver lesions to support effective treatment planning. Additionally, Prof. Karcaaltincaba shared insights into the potential integ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ning in radiology, promising significant improvements in diagnostic procedures.

Cutting-Edge Developments in Prostate and Female Pelvis MRI

The discussion also covered groundbreaking progress in MRI for the prostate and female pelvis. Prof. Karcaaltincaba elaborated on the enhancements brought about by the updated PI-RADS v2.1 standards, which are critical for the early detection and treatment of prostate cancer. He also introduced the implementation of O-RADS MRI standards for ovarian tumors, which aid in the precise diagnosis and risk assessment of ovarian masses. His presentation concluded with an exploration of MRI techniques used in the identification and differential diagnosis of myomas, enriching the diagnostic tools available for common uterine conditions.

Application in Clinical Settings

Prof. Karcaaltincaba enriched the sessions with case studies that demonstrated the application of these advanced MRI techniques in clinical settings. These real-world examples not only showcased the practical advantages of the latest technology but also emphasized their impact on improving patient outcomes. This approach helped deepen the understanding and appreciation of the new techniques among the attendees.

Conclusion

The joint effort by Medtech Medical Ltd and the Radiological Society of Mauritius in organizing this conference highlighted their dedication to advancing medical education and healthcare outcomes in the region. The lectures delivered by Prof. Karcaaltincaba offered a comprehensive overview of current and emerging MRI technologies, arming healthcare professionals both locally and globally with crucial knowledge and skills.
